Synod 2025 voted to encourage churches to support the spiritual health of pastoral spouses including providing at least $500 each year for resources for the spiritual care of the pastoral spouses in their church. Synod is the annual general assembly of the Christian Reformed Church in North America. It is meeting June 13-19 in Ancaster, Ont.
The requirement is grounded on the basis that “healthy churches depend on healthy pastors and healthy spouses.”
Some lamented that more couldn’t be done to support spouses of pastors. Paul VanderKlay, Classis Central California, who chaired the committee that considered the request, said, “This was the best that we could do to offer something to the church.” Scott Elgersma, Classis California South, acknowledged the importance of this support saying, “I wish we could do better than this, and I wish we could work on it (the proposal) more, but I don’t think we’re going to do that.”
Ren Tubergen, Classis Thornapple Valley, was against the recommendation because “the boundaries proposed are unclear.” He acknowledged ministry is hard and support is important. Rob Toornstra, Classis Columbia, expressed concern about synod “directing local churches on how to allocate their money.” He said he’d prefer if it was mandated to the classes to create a fund, or for the regional pastors to decide saying, “It seems a little too ‘top-down.’”
Synod also encouraged “classes to create a fund to help local churches who cannot afford the resources for the care of pastoral spouses.” Regional pastors and church visitors are directed to “ask after the health of the pastoral spouse in their contacts with pastors and churches.”
Finally, Synod 2025 instructed the Office of the General Secretary to curate more resources for how to support the spiritual care of pastoral spouses, noting there are currently minimal resources available.
